Removing the Curse

And Noah builded an altar unto the LORD; and took of every clean beast, and of every clean fowl, and offered burnt offerings on the altar. And the LORD smelled a sweet savour; and the LORD said in his heart, I will not again curse the ground any more for man’s sake; for the imagination of man’s heart is evil from his youth; neither will I again smite any more every thing living, as I have done.

(Genesis 8:20-21) KJV

Noah’s flood pictures the cleansing that we receive symbolically in baptism. The Earth was baptized and regenerated. Harmful pollutants which had been accumulating since the fall of man were washed into the oceans.

It caught us off guard because original sin isn’t a curse. Original sin can’t be removed, it happened and it’s going to stay happened.

If the Tweeter was referring to the punishment that resulted, meaning death, then that’s not a curse it’s a punishment. It can’t be removed either, it’s a necessary part of the plan of redemption through faith in Jesus Christ. If there was no punishment for sin then we wouldn’t need a savior. As we all know, we’re all sinners and we all need a savior.

The other thing that it could be was the curse that God put on the ground. In Matty’s Paradigm this is the moment when God withdrew his physical presence from the Earth and nuclear decay began. The cursed Earth. Could this curse be removed? No, not really, but the hazardous products of nuclear decay could be cleansed, so that may be what we’re talking about.

Was a curse removed? And if so, when and where did it occur? We’re going to answer this question by bringing in the concepts of purification and cleansing, the ordinance of baptism and our regeneration.
